laravel 實現(xiàn)劃分admin和home 模塊分組
我們使用tp或者yii2的時候,會將網(wǎng)站的前臺和后臺按照模塊分組。yii2的高級模板已經(jīng)幫我們劃分好了,tp系列框架需要自己配置分組。那么laravel5該怎么劃分這樣的模塊呢?
routes.php
<?php /* |-------------------------------------------------------------------------- | Application Routes |-------------------------------------------------------------------------- | | Here is where you can register all of the routes for an application. | It's a breeze. Simply tell Laravel the URIs it should respond to | and give it the controller to call when that URI is requested. | */ //默認控制器 Route::get('/', 'Home\IndexController@index'); //前臺路由組 Route::group(['namespace' => 'Home'], function(){ // 控制器在 "App\Http\Controllers\Home" 命名空間下 Route::get('/', [ 'as' => 'index', 'uses' => 'IndexController@index' ]); }); //后臺路由組 Route::group(['namespace' => 'Admin', 'prefix' => 'admin'], function(){ // 控制器在 "App\Http\Controllers\Admin" 命名空間下 Route::get('/', [ 'as' => 'index', 'uses' => 'IndexController@index' ]); });
設(shè)置了命名空間,admin后臺控制器,統(tǒng)一加了admin前綴。并且設(shè)置了默認訪問的控制器,Home文件夾下的Index控制器的index方法。
Home\IndexController.php
<?php /** * author: NickBai * createTime: 2017/2/6 0006 上午 9:05 */ namespace App\Http\Controllers\Home; use App\Http\Controllers\Controller; class IndexController extends Controller { public function index() { return 'this is home'; } }
Admin\IndexController.php
<?php /** * author: NickBai * createTime: 2017/2/6 0006 上午 9:03 */ namespace App\Http\Controllers\Admin; use App\Http\Controllers\Controller; class IndexController extends Controller { public function index() { return 'this is admin'; } }
此時訪問 domain(你的域名)即可訪問前臺,domain/admin 即可訪問admin后臺
以上這篇laravel 實現(xiàn)劃分admin和home 模塊分組就是小編分享給大家的全部內(nèi)容了,希望能給大家一個參考,也希望大家多多支持腳本之家。
相關(guān)文章
如何用PHP來實現(xiàn)一個動態(tài)Web服務(wù)器
這篇文章介紹了如何用PHP來實現(xiàn)一個動態(tài)Web服務(wù)器,文章思路清晰,并附有演示代碼地址,需要的朋友可以參考下2015-07-07thinkPHP5框架整合plupload實現(xiàn)圖片批量上傳功能的方法
這篇文章主要介紹了thinkPHP5框架整合plupload實現(xiàn)圖片批量上傳功能的方法,結(jié)合實例形式分析了thinkPHP結(jié)合pluploadQueue實現(xiàn)上傳功能的相關(guān)操作技巧,需要的朋友可以參考下2017-11-11PHP圖片等比縮放類SimpleImage使用方法和使用實例分享
這篇文章主要介紹了PHP圖片等比縮放類SimpleImage使用方法和使用實例分享,需要的朋友可以參考下2014-04-04編寫PHP程序檢查字符串中的中文字符個數(shù)的實例分享
這篇文章主要介紹了編寫PHP程序檢查字符串中的中文字符個數(shù)的實例分享,文中利用了PHP中mb_strlen函數(shù)的實現(xiàn)原理,需要的朋友可以參考下2016-03-03PHP+Jquery與ajax相結(jié)合實現(xiàn)下拉淡出瀑布流效果【無需插件】
這篇文章主要介紹了PHP+Jquery與ajax相結(jié)合實現(xiàn)下拉淡出瀑布流效果【無需插件】的相關(guān)資料,需要的朋友可以參考下2016-05-05